Title: Unhappy Candy Hearts. I took a picture (with a frame) and painted over it with purple metallic acrylic paint. I glued the candy hearts on, then wrote some not-so-happy sayings...not realizing the marker bleeds insanely! So the words came out BIGGER than I wanted but atleast the marker didn't blur the words completely.

Next I dripped the purple paint on each heart...then black and white. Originally didn't want to cover up the hearts that have paint completely on them...there were words written on them too....the paint kinda did what it wanted.
